Output 8df6013cdbae9784ac289df150f4cadcc475f78a100d1582bf083c03327b94f4:8

value
24711320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dcabda6c8f82fc400761242fddc650451e38f83 OP_EQUAL
address
MSfHdSBYBjGE9Rbn61J9AMTWLTXSZ99wEh
transaction
8df6013cdbae9784ac289df150f4cadcc475f78a100d1582bf083c03327b94f4
spent
true